SUNBLOCK: Swimming or not, the skin needs to be protected from the UV rays of the sun. It may feel a bit sticky on the skin but it's a small price to pay rather than getting sunburned or worse. I prefer the lotion type from Nivea, but there's this spray one too.









WATER: Need I say more? (although these bottles are empty, but you get the point) Carrying a water bottle might be heavy but you need to keep yourself hydrated. You may recycle plastic bottles since they're lighter, but take note not to use them a bunch of times for it may have health hazards too. LIP BALM: When your skin feels dry, your lips feel that too. Heat makes the lips dry and chapped, so always keep a lip balm in hand to moisturize those lips. I preferably go for just simple vaseline because it feels more hydrating to the lips. This Nivea lipbalm  is just like vaseline but in a tube. WIPES: In contrast to the dry towel, wet wipes are a go to for freshening up. Go for the non-alcoholic baby wipes that are unscented if you have sensitive skin. Although these are my favorites from Sanicare and the cucumber ones from Watson's, just because it makes the sweaty smell go away too.




HAT: Summer is the best excuse to keep wearing caps and even floppy hats. It gives you shade to protect your face and it's fashionable! Plus, given the bipolar weather we have, it may be sunny now and then it may rain later on. An alternative to an umbrella which is heavier to carry around.





SUNGLASSES: Speaking of fashionable sun protection, it is the time to bring out those shades. Since you can't put sunblock on your eyes, they need to be protected from UV too. Also, I heard squinting can strain your eyes and may affect your vision. (Sunnies)
